• Expanding Diagnostics Horizons: Latex Agglutination Test Kit Market Analysis
    The Latex Agglutination Test Kit Market is experiencing a transformative shift as healthcare systems globally embrace more efficient and cost-effective diagnostic solutions. Latex agglutination testing, which relies on antigen-antibody interactions visible to the naked eye, has become a trusted method for rapid disease diagnosis. Its applications range from detecting infectious diseases like meningitis and pneumonia to identifying bacterial and viral pathogens in blood, urine, and cerebrospinal fluid samples. This diagnostic technique’s affordability, accuracy, and ease of use are driving its adoption in both developed and developing countries. Hospitals and laboratories are investing heavily in automated test kits to minimize human error and improve consistency. Additionally, the integration of AI-driven image recognition tools is further refining result interpretation, supporting a future of faster, more precise diagnostics.

  • Innovations Shaping the Dental Soft Tissue Regeneration Market Analysis
    The global dental industry has been experiencing a remarkable transformation in recent years, particularly within the field of soft tissue regeneration. Dental soft tissue regeneration focuses on restoring or replacing gum tissues and other supporting oral structures that may be lost due to periodontal disease, trauma, or surgical procedures. Advances in biomaterials, tissue engineering, and regenerative medicine have expanded treatment options for both clinicians and patients. This shift is not only improving oral health outcomes but also driving strong market potential across various regions. According to industry experts, innovations such as bioactive scaffolds, growth factor–enriched products, and stem cell–based therapies are becoming central to periodontal treatment approaches. The increasing demand for minimally invasive procedures and faster recovery times is influencing dental professionals to adopt cutting-edge techniques that redefine patient care. The Dental Soft Tissue Regeneration Market analysis highlights that ongoing research and investment in this field are leading to more predictable outcomes, higher patient satisfaction, and a growing reliance on advanced biomaterials in clinical practice.
